Overall, I’m happy with what we’ve done this window, but I think we’re one or two players short of what we probably wanted. I’m not suggesting huge great overhaul because we’ve clearly a winning formula atm, but players who can push for places. Due to the flexibility of the players we have, we can be a bit picky with where we spend our money and walk away from any clubs playing silly beggars over fees.

For me, if Jack is playing on the left, then we need another central midfielder. If we intend to move him more central at Conor’s expense, then we will need another winger. 
 

And then there’s the striker issue: will we go into the season with Keinan and Ollie as central strikers? If the idea is for Traore to play more centrally in the event of an injury to Ollie or Keinan, then we definitely need another wide player. 
 

Would like to see a couple more outgoings, too. Delighted to see Hogan go. I’m resigned to Henri sticking around - might be good for morale to have the handsome b+stard about -  but I’d really like some movement to get Kalinic or Nyland at least partly off the wage bill.
